Why Are Starfield Ship Parts Not Working?

Ship Parts hold a pivotal role in the Starfield gaming experience, enabling players to carry out essential ship repairs during intense battles, thereby securing their survival in the game. There exist various factors that can lead to ship parts malfunctioning within Starfield:

1. Ship Parts Not in the Cargo Hold

A common issue encountered by numerous users is the inability to utilize ship parts for repairing their vessels unless they are situated within the cargo hold. It is imperative to confirm that your ship parts are stored in the cargo hold prior to any repair attempts.

2. Incorrect Key Bindings

A prevalent error made by players involves employing an incorrect key binding, often pressing the default O (zero) key on the controller, which proves ineffective. To effectively utilize ship parts, it is imperative to employ the correct key binding.

How to Fix Starfield Ship Parts Not Working?

In case you encounter the “Starfield Ship Parts Not Working” problem, here are a few potential solutions to help you rectify the issue:

1. Move Starfield Ship Parts to the Cargo Hold

To repair your spaceship with ship parts in Starfield, it is essential to have the parts stored within your ship’s cargo hold. Several users have shared their experiences of being unable to utilize ship parts for repairs until they relocated them to the cargo hold.

2. Restart the Game

One straightforward solution to consider is closing the Starfield game and then reopening it. Oftentimes, simply restarting the game can address a range of problems, including the ship parts not working issue. After you’ve restarted the game, make sure to check if the problem has been resolved.

3. Use the Correct Key Bindings

For Xbox Series X|S and PC users, employing the correct key bindings is crucial when repairing your ship in Starfield.

**For Xbox Series X|S users:**

1. Confirm that you have the required ship parts stored in your ship’s cargo hold.
2. While inside your spaceship, press the right thumbstick (RS button) on your Xbox controller.
Alternatively, you can press the circle (orange key) on your controller to commence the repair process.

**For PC users:**

1. Ensure that you possess the necessary ship parts in your ship’s cargo hold.
2. While inside your spaceship, press the R key on your keyboard to initiate the repair process.

4. Check for Updates

Playing Starfield with an outdated game version can lead to various in-game features malfunctioning. To prevent glitches and ensure optimal performance, it’s essential to routinely check for and install the latest game updates.

**For Steam users:**

1. Launch the Steam client on your computer.
2. Navigate to the “Library” tab.
3. Locate Starfield in your list of games.
4. If an update is available, it should commence downloading automatically.
5. If no update is accessible, try restarting Steam or your computer to prompt the update.

**For Xbox users:**

1. Power on your Xbox console.
2. Press the Xbox button on your controller to open the guide.
3. Navigate to “Profile & System” and select “Settings.”
4. Choose “System” and then “Updates.”
5. If an update is available for Starfield, it will be listed here.
6. Follow the on-screen instructions to download and install the update.

5. Verify Game Files

If the persistent issue of ship parts not working arises, it might be due to corrupted or missing game files. To resolve this problem, verifying the integrity of Starfield game files can be a helpful step.

**For Steam users:**

1. Launch the Steam client on your computer.
2. Head to the “Library” tab.
3. Right-click on Starfield and choose “Properties.”
4. Select the “Local Files” tab.
5. Click on “Verify Integrity of Game Files.”
6. Wait for the verification process to complete.
7. Any missing or damaged files will be replaced with new ones.

**For Xbox users:**

1. Power on your Xbox console.
2. Locate the Starfield game icon on your home screen.
3. Press the “Options” button on your controller.
4. Select “Manage game & add-ons.”
5. Choose “Saved data.”
6. Opt for “Delete all.”
7. Confirm the deletion of all saved data.
8. Restart the game to see if the issue is resolved.
